Lawn erosion repair services involve stabilizing and restoring areas where soil has been displaced or washed away, often due to heavy rain, poor drainage, or improper landscaping. These professionals typically assess the affected zones to determine the underlying causes and then implement solutions such as installing erosion control mats, planting ground covers, or adding retaining features. The goal is to create a stable, healthy lawn that resists future erosion and maintains its appearance and functionality over time. This process often includes grading the land to improve water flow and prevent pooling, ensuring the landscape remains resilient against weather-related wear.

Erosion problems can lead to several issues for property owners, including uneven lawns, loss of topsoil, and damage to existing landscaping or structures. In severe cases, erosion can threaten the integrity of walkways, driveways, or foundations if not addressed promptly. Lawn erosion repair services help homeowners prevent these complications by reinforcing vulnerable areas and establishing a more durable landscape. Regular maintenance and timely repairs can also help avoid more costly fixes down the line, making erosion control a practical investment for maintaining property value and safety.

These services are commonly used on residential properties with sloped yards, gardens, or lawns that experience frequent runoff. Homes situated on hilly terrain or with poorly graded landscapes are particularly susceptible to erosion issues. Additionally, properties with recent landscaping changes or areas that have been disturbed by construction may require erosion repair to stabilize the soil. Whether a homeowner is dealing with minor rills or more extensive soil loss, local contractors can provide tailored solutions to restore and protect the lawn’s stability and appearance.

The overview below groups typical Lawn Erosion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Niagara Falls, NY.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or erosion fixes, such as patching or reseeding small areas, range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and soil conditions.

Moderate Projects - Repairing larger sections of eroded lawn or installing simple retaining features can cost between $600-$1,500. These projects are common and usually involve more extensive soil stabilization efforts.

Extensive Restoration - Significant erosion issues requiring grading, drainage improvements, or custom solutions often range from $1,500-$3,500. Fewer projects reach this tier, but they involve more complex work to restore stability.

Full Replacement - Complete lawn replacement or major regrading can exceed $3,500, with larger, more complex projects sometimes reaching $5,000 or more. These are typically reserved for severe erosion cases or extensive landscape redesigns.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es lawn erosion that needs repair? Lawn erosion can result from heavy rainfall, poor drainage, or inadequate ground stabilization, leading to soil loss and uneven turf.

How can local contractors fix lawn erosion? They typically assess the affected area, then implement solutions such as grading, adding erosion control fabrics, or planting ground cover to prevent further damage.

Are there different methods for repairing lawn erosion? Yes, options include installing retaining walls, applying soil stabilizers, or regrading the lawn to improve slope and drainage.

What signs indicate that lawn erosion repair is needed? Visible bare patches, gullies, or areas where soil is washing away during rain are common indicators.

Will repair work restore the lawn's appearance? Proper erosion repair can improve the lawn’s stability and appearance, helping to prevent future damage and promote healthy grass growth.
